Determines the IP address of a bunch, given the host's identify. The host name can possibly be considered a machine title, which include "java.Solar.com", or a textual representation of its IP address. If a literal IP address is provided, only the validity in the address format is checked. For host laid out in literal IPv6 address, both the shape defined in RFC 2732 or perhaps the literal IPv6 address structure defined in RFC 2373 is acknowledged.
Having said that, it’s vital that you Be aware that all transactions and sensible agreement interactions are publicly obvious within the Ethereum blockchain.
Your Ethereum address is your identity over the Ethereum network. It is needed to connect with the network and complete transactions. To carry on Discovering Ethers.js, look at this manual on How to ship an Ethereum transaction applying Ethers.js. Get more information on Ethers.js from their Formal documentation. When you noticed, producing a new Ethereum address is promptly performed with JavaScript and the latest libraries.
While in the worst case they'll assume that it is legitimate and generate an address that can't be utilized. The private vital will not likely generate a legitimate signature, so You can not commit money within the address. Ideal case wallets will complain and refuse to use the private critical.
However, the python implementation allows you to see step by step the elliptic curve math used to derive the general public essential.
Once you generate an Ethereum address, it is crucial to know that all transactions manufactured employing that address are recorded about the blockchain, that's a community ledger.
If there is a security supervisor, its checkConnect technique is termed Together with the regional host name and -1 as its arguments to determine When the operation is permitted. In case the operation just isn't permitted, an InetAddress representing the loopback address is returned.
To generate a unique Ethereum address, you may need to comprehend the complex mechanics driving its development method. The process of generating a novel Ethereum address requires various techniques:
Another vital parameter in secp256k1 is definitely the place to begin G. Since G is a degree on the elliptic curve, it can be 2-dimensional and it has the parameters
Each and every bash associated with the multi-signature address has their very own private critical, along with a specified number of signatures are expected to complete a transaction.
Everybody can begin to see the method as well as inputs so there is absolutely no doubt about the result. You will need to accept unpredictable. Even that is difficult. Employing "now" Visit Site like a supply of randomness can be a step in the best direction, but you can find issues:
To guarantee sleek Ethereum transactions using Ethereum addresses for sending and receiving ETH, it’s vital that you know about prevalent faults to stay away from.
When producing an Ethereum address, it’s vital in your case to be familiar with the role important pairs Perform in making certain the integrity and privacy of your address. Essential pairs include a community essential and also a private vital, they usually’re essential to the safety of your Ethereum address.
Ideal procedures for Ethereum address generation contain maintaining private keys protected, working with hardware wallets, and frequently updating software.